WebCitrus can be kept in 10-12 inch pots for several years. Larger containers will allow the tree to grow bigger and more productive but these may be harder to move. Plants should be repotted every year or two. Grow citrus in well-drained potting medium and keep it moist, but not wet. Citrus trees require soil that is moist but never soggy. WebNov 29, 2024 · A lemon cypress prefers cool, moist climates. Temperatures above 80 degrees F in dry areas will tax the plant, while temperatures lower than 20 degrees F may cause tree damage or death. When used as a houseplant, the lemon cypress needs to be kept in a place that has sufficient humidity. Fertilizer# Fertilizing this shrub is not suggested.
